Choosing the Right Shades of Pink and White for Your Basement

The first step in any design project is to choose your color palette. When it comes to pink and white, there’s an endless array of shades and tones to choose from. To create a cohesive and sophisticated look, consider using shades of blush, cream, and pearl. These soft, natural colors work together seamlessly to create a calming and inviting atmosphere. If you prefer a bolder look, you can opt for brighter shades of pink, such as fuchsia or magenta, to add a pop of color to your space.

It’s important to also consider the lighting in your basement when choosing your color palette. If your basement has limited natural light, it’s best to avoid using dark shades of pink and white, as they can make the space feel smaller and more cramped. Instead, opt for lighter shades that will reflect the available light and make the space feel brighter and more open. Additionally, you can incorporate metallic accents, such as gold or silver, to add a touch of glamour and reflect light throughout the space.

Adding Texture and Contrast to Your Pink and White Basement Design

A pink and white color scheme can be beautiful, but it can also feel flat without the proper use of texture and contrast. To add interest to your basement design, try incorporating textured accents such as shaggy rugs, woven baskets, and textured wall decor. Similarly, you can add a pop of contrast with black accent pieces like picture frames, lamps, or even some black pillows on a white couch. A white or light-colored rug with darker accents can also create contrast and add visual interest.

Another way to add texture and contrast to your pink and white basement design is by incorporating different materials. For example, you can mix and match materials like wood, metal, and glass to create a visually interesting space. A wooden coffee table with metal legs or a glass vase with a wooden base can add depth and texture to your design. Additionally, you can play with different patterns and prints, such as a striped or floral accent wall or patterned throw pillows on a solid-colored couch. By incorporating a variety of textures, materials, and patterns, you can create a dynamic and visually appealing pink and white basement design.

Incorporating Plants and Greenery into Your Pink and White Basement Space

No design is complete without the addition of some living greenery. Plants can breathe new life into any dull space. Incorporating real or artificial plants to your pink and white basement will add a sense of freshness and tranquility. You can add plants in a variety of ways- hanging baskets, planters on the floor, or even a vertical garden. Succulents require minimal upkeep, while leafy plants can add depth and texture.

Not only do plants add aesthetic value to your basement space, but they also have numerous health benefits. Plants can improve air quality by removing toxins and pollutants from the air. They can also reduce stress and anxiety levels, and even boost productivity. Some great plant options for your basement include snake plants, spider plants, and peace lilies. Just be sure to choose plants that thrive in low-light environments, as basements typically have limited natural light.
